WOLLHEIM, J.
Petitioner appeals the trial court's judgment requiring him to pay $975 for the cost of his own court-appointed attorney in the underlying post-conviction proceeding. We conclude that no statute authorized the judgment of costs in this action and that the court's imposition of those costs was error apparent on the face of the record. Accordingly, although we affirm the trial court's disposition of the merits, we vacate the judgment for costs of $975....
